The Kanak Awakening : : The Rise of Nationalism in New Caledonia / / David A. Chappell.
In 1853, France annexed the Melanesian islands of New Caledonia to establish a convict colony and strategic port of call. Unlike other European settler-dominated countries in the Pacific, the territory's indigenous people remained more numerous than immigrants for over a century. Despite milita...
